The famous dialogue between Khrisna and Arjuna

Image
 The Bhagavad Gita, a sacred Hindu scripture, recounts a profound dialogue between Lord Krishna and Arjuna on the eve of the great Mahabharata war. As Arjuna stood on the battlefield, grappling with moral dilemmas and existential crises, Krishna imparted timeless wisdom to guide him through the turmoil. Krishna's teachings emphasized the importance of selfless action (Nishkam Karma), detachment from outcomes (Vairagya), and the pursuit of one's duty (Swadharma). He urged Arjuna to transcend his personal doubts and emotions, and instead, focus on performing his duty as a warrior. This ancient dialogue holds remarkable relevance in today's world.
